Asbestos, a hazardous material is employed in construction, manufacturing and other industries for decades. Mesothelioma is a danger for people who worked with asbestos-containing materials like pipes, insulation, and sealants. Even a small amount of exposure to asbestos can cause mesothelioma, which can affect the lining of the abdomen, heart and the lungs.

There are a variety of types of mesothelioma and each has its own symptoms. Treatment for mesothelioma is costly and affect the patient's ability to work. As a result, mesothelioma lawsuits may include compensation for the loss of income and wages.

Another crucial aspect of mesothelioma lawsuits is the wrongful death lawsuits. These lawsuits are filed on behalf of family members who have lost a loved one due to Asbestos Claim exposure. Family members can be awarded compensation for funeral expenses, loss of companionship, and other damages.

Based on the state, asbestos victims and their families may be able to receive compensation from asbestos trust funds. These trusts were created through the bankruptcy of asbestos legal-producing or asbestos-using businesses. These trusts hold assets that may be used to pay asbestos-related legal costs. Trusts that are created can increase the amount of settlements paid for mesothelioma by a significant amount.
